Prisoner Letter Writing Night, November 6th, 5-7pm

On the first and third Sunday of every month, a little crew of folks have been getting together at Pipsqueak to write letters and cards to various prisoners in an attempt to create a culture of support and solidarity and to also break down the walls of communication that incarceration brings. This week we’ll be focusing on Josh Williams and Josh “Zero” Cartrette, two prisoners currently facing repression from within the walls of confinement.

From https://antistatestl.noblogs.org/ferguson-related-prisoners/
“Josh Williams was sentenced on December 10th, 2015 to 8 years in prison for trying to burn down a Quik Trip during a demonstration in Berkeley, MO on Christmas Eve, 2014 that was held in response to the police murder of Antonio Martin.”

According to a call-out from his support crew https://www.instagram.com/p/BLxDcrhgHeH/?taken-by=nycabc he’s been put in a level 5 facility, known particularly for its violence. We’re gonna focus on getting letters and cards to him this week, also because his birthday is on November 25th! Let’s send some fiery greetings his way.

And closer to our part of the world is Zero, an anarchist prisoner in Pendleton, OR who is currently facing repression and solitary confinement for his alleged attempts in agitating for the September 9th Prison Strike.
